Description

FIG. 1 is a front, left, top perspective view of a rack, showing the new design in an open configuration without a lid;

FIG. 2 is rear, right, bottom perspective view thereof;

FIG. 3 is a right side view thereof;

FIG. 4 is a left side view thereof;

FIG. 5 is a front elevation view thereof;

FIG. 6 is a rear elevation view thereof;

FIG. 7 is a top plan view thereof; and,

FIG. 8 is a bottom plan view thereof.

In the drawings, the broken lines depict portions of the rack that form no part of the claimed design.

Claims

The ornamental design for a rack, as shown and described.
